Topic

An updated ovirt-node package that fixes various bugs and contains a number of
enhancements is now available.

Description

The ovirt-node package provides the utilities and recipes used to create and
configure the Red Hat Enterprise Virtualization Hypervisor ISO image.

Note: Red Hat Enterprise Virtualization Hypervisor is only available for the
Intel 64 and AMD64 architectures with virtualization extensions.

This update fixes the following bugs:

  • Automatic installation failed to set the hostname, DNS, and NTP parameters.

This was because the migration script was also run on first boot after a clean
installation. Now, the configuration version is set during installation, and
prevents migration runs when it is a fresh installation. As a result, the
hostname, DNS and NTP parameters can be set after automatic installation.
(BZ#1055558)

  • Upgrading the hypervisor did not retain some previously configured settings

including hostname, network, logging, and remote storage. All parameters are now
persisted in the TUI after an upgrade. (BZ#1055554)

  • The NVR of the hypervisor RPM and the contents of /etc/system-release did not

match, so the Manager prompted users to upgrade the hypervisor even when there
were no updates available. The version information in both locations now match,
so users are only prompted to upgrade when there are new versions available.
(BZ#1055553)

Changes to the ovirt-node component:

  • SAM proxy passwords are now masked in the log, not shows as plaintext.

(BZ#971235)

  • syslinux-extlinux package has been added to the RHEV-H channel and edit-node

now works as expected. (BZ#1013828)

  • The upgrade path is now independent of the installation path and TUI-based

upgrades work. (BZ#1064394)

  • The total amount of available disk space is now shown to the user during

installation. (BZ#1063959)

  • A convert_to_biodevsname exception is no longer raised during booting.

(BZ#1063960)

  • Puppet clients now wait 60 seconds before timing out. (BZ#1063962)
  • All menu buttons consistently use "Continue". (BZ#1063963)
  • Hostname, DNS and NTP parameters can now be set after automatic installation.

(BZ#1063964)

  • /var/lib/puppet is now persisted, and puppet works after reboot. (BZ#1063965)
  • cim passwords set during auto-installation are now reported correctly in the

log. (BZ#1063966)

  • ovirt-node now uses the ovirt-node-selinux subpackage, improving runtime

rules. (BZ#1063967)

  • Installation codebase now has the same defaults as in RHEL 6.4, which allows

users to assume the same behavior as in RHEL 6.4. (BZ#1063969)

  • Proxy information for systems registered to SAM is shown correctly in the TUI.

(BZ#1063971)

  • The TUI now correctly shows that "SAM" and not "classic" was chosen during

auto-installation. (BZ#1064284)

  • The TUI reports that "You have not provided a new password" only when the user

does not specify a new password. (BZ#1063974)

  • RHN now reports proxy information for registered proxies. (BZ#1063976)
  • Upgrades of RHEV-H are now reflected on the RHN website. (BZ#1063986)
  • Updating RHEV-H via the ovirt-node-upgrade tool now works. (BZ#1063987)
  • The TUI no longer quits when you press "CTRL+C" twice. (BZ#1063988)
  • RHEV-H now installs on the disk selected by the user in the TUI. (BZ#1063989)
  • FQDN or IP Address for a proxy server can now be set in the TUI. (BZ#1063991)
  • It is now possible to remove the NFSv4 domain after it has been set.

(BZ#1063993)

  • All puppet-related configuration information is now deleted when users disable

puppet. (BZ#1063994)

  • The RHN web interface now displays the profile names of systems registered

with the SAM. (BZ#1063995)

  • Kdump can now be configured to use an ssh or nfs target. (BZ#1063997)
  • Bonds can now be created during auto-installation of RHEV-H. (BZ#1063972)
